security briefs: Miserable single's schedule trumps deviant behavior

Andrew Moll

Issue date: 2/15/07 Section: Campus
As many of you know, Valentine's Day was on Wednesday. This is the day of the year where the lovers of the world unite and celebrate their love with heart and candy and lingerie and a lot of pink stuff. On the other side of the coin, those of us who remain eternally single do our best to go through the day making it seem like we're indifferent to the whole thing when in actuality we're insanely jealous and bitter about it all. Not exactly my favorite day of the year. Nevertheless, I decided to keep a running diary of the proceedings. Read at your own risk.

8:30 - Roll out of bed and put up an anti-Valentine's Day away message, and feel better about myself for a minute.

9:15 - Leave for class while putting on my moody face and iPod. On the iPod? The Smiths, of course. (Note: This is subject to change depending on whether or not classes were canceled on Wednesday. Remember, I'm writing this on Tuesday.)

9:30-10:45 - Spend my class time contemplating whether or not I should sport some Robert Smith-esque eyeliner and lipstick, then decide that that's probably not the best idea; but the decision is made to keep The Cure on stand-by for listening later in the day.

11:00-Noon - Come back to my room for a nap because life is oh so difficult and I can't stand having to be awake and deal with this cruel, cruel world! Oh the humanity!

12:30 - Lunch. Easy Mac. Yum.

1:00 - Start listening to Morrissey, because he sings about how I feel and I can relate to his lyrics. Kinda like how some kids feel about My Chemical Romance, or Fall Out Boy, or Panic! At The Disco, or other emo bands. (Note: Not all emo is bad. Just new emo.[Note: Four words: Sunny Day Real Estate]).

3:30 - I can't do my homework! Life is too dreadful! Why can't I be loved?! Why am I not good enough?! Oh the humanity!

4:00 - Actually, yeah, I think I'm gonna get my homework done. Besides, not like I have anything else worthwhile to do.

5:30 - Dinner. Easy Mac. Yum.
